Hidden Family Vermin



Are you knowledgeable about the hidden house insects that may be lurking in your house? While you might be vigilant concerning common insects like ants or crawlers, there are various other tricky intruders that could be triggering damage behind the scenes.



One such bug is the silverfish, a tiny insect that grows in wet and dark environments like cellars and washrooms. These insects can damage books, garments, and also wallpaper, making them an annoyance to deal with.

One more surprise parasite to look out for is the carpeting beetle. These little pests eat a selection of materials found in homes, such as carpetings, apparel, and furniture. Their larvae can trigger considerable damages if left uncontrolled, making it essential to resolve any indicators of problem quickly.

Furthermore, mold termites are usually overlooked yet can show a dampness issue in your house. These tiny animals feed upon mold and mildew and can get worse allergies for delicate individuals. Maintaining your home completely dry and well-ventilated can assist stop these bugs from settling in your living spaces.

Sneaky Home Invaders



While you might be diligent in keeping your home clean and arranged, tricky home intruders can still locate their way in undetected. These insects are masters of hiding in plain sight, making it important to stay cautious in identifying their existence.

Right here are a couple of tricky home intruders you must watch out for:

1. ** Silverfish **: These little, silvery pests like damp, dark areas like basements and bathrooms. They prey on starchy products and can cause damages to books, wallpaper, and garments.

2. ** Carpet Beetles **: Typically incorrect for harmless ladybugs, carpeting beetles can ruin your home. Their larvae feed upon all-natural fibers like wool and silk, triggering irreparable damages to carpets, apparel, and upholstery.
